> > Is the OpenBSD mangling the packet in any way?
>
> It is certainly possible but everything works fine with all other OSes
> and kernels 2.6.5 and below which leads me to believe something was
> changed in 2.6.6 that broke it.
>
> Are you able to reproduce it ?
OpenBSD packet filter is busted, and the maintainer of
it claims this is not a bug.
That changes in 2.6.6 didn't "break" things, it enabled a
feature in TCP that OpenBSD stateless TCP connection tracking
cannot handle, and old TCP feature in fact, window scaling.
